更新日志 – Android

10.6.0.0

  • AI:默认多轮对话模式
    • 对话保存在历史记录中
    • 可以同时启动多个对话
    • 默认使用代码模式,可完全访问编辑器
    • 直接支持 markdown 对话
    • 支持文件更改的差异视图
  • AI:修复获取当前文件、获取选区、编辑文件等多种工具的错误
  • Remote:支持通过 Remote 协议使用 ACP
    • 从 AI 对话功能访问 Claude Code、Gemini CLI 或 Codex
    • 直接使用订阅计划,不消耗 Credit
    • 需要 CLI 版本 0.6.0+
    • 支持通过 ACP 进行权限确认(允许编辑)
    • 通过 AI 对话源选择启用(设置为 CLI 而非 Cloud — 需要 CLI 0.6.0+)
  • Labs:索引功能的更改

10.5.0.0

  • Remote CLI:新增 LSP 服务器支持(需要 CLI 0.5.0+),更智能的项目级自动补全,支持 import 解析
  • Remote CLI:新增打开浏览器预览的快捷键
  • 自动补全:新增基于图结构的 import 感知自动补全(受内存占用限制)
  • 文档:改进了应用文档,支持多种语言

10.4.0.0

  • Remote CLI:支持本地项目与远程项目之间的双向复制/粘贴
    • 可将远程项目用作桌面、移动设备和远程服务器之间的快速文件共享
  • 自动补全:支持使用 pyright 语言服务器进行 Python (.py) 智能自动补全

10.3.1.0

  • 修复:防止长时间空闲后恢复应用程序时出现卡死问题
  • 文件系统:新增统计信息弹窗,显示文件元数据,如最后修改时间和文件大小
  • 远程 CLI:修复不兼容的 stats 结构可能导致文件系统问题
  • 远程 CLI:改进 iOS 上的浏览器代理,支持部分根路径代理(支持 vite 模板)

10.3.0.0

  • UI: 界面样式和对齐方式的小幅改进
  • 编辑器: 为图像预览添加缩放控件
  • 远程 CLI: 支持预览二进制文件及音频/视频流
  • 远程 CLI: 支持远程浏览器代理
    • 在远程机器上预览浏览器
  • 远程 CLI: 修复手动远程机器登录的身份验证机制
    • 当尝试使用无浏览器的远程服务器登录时,之前的身份验证机制已损坏
    • 适用于通过 SSH 会话从虚拟服务器主机登录 CLI(需要 spck cli 0.2.0+)
  • 远程 CLI: 修复删除当前活动文件的错误
  • 远程 CLI: 修复保存二进制文件的问题

10.2.0.0

  • 模板:新增 D3、three.js、anime.js 等模板
  • AI:改进工具及工具状态显示
  • 编辑器:修复原子写入中的竞争条件
  • 设置:偏好设置切换为原子写入
  • 远程 CLI:扫描相同二维码两次可自动连接

10.1.0.0

  • AI:添加代码模式,允许 AI 代理直接读取/编辑项目中的文件
    • 在 AI 提示模态框中切换聊天(旧行为)和代码模式
  • AI:更新模型,移除 OpenAI 模型,添加编码性能与 Claude 相当的开源模型(Qwen、DeepSeek、GLM)
  • AI:所有模型添加可变信用消耗,由每个模型的最大令牌输出决定
    • 达到令牌限制时不再截断输出
    • 在账户中添加最大令牌上限设置,以限制单次提示使用的信用额度,设置为1x可恢复旧行为
  • AI:为聊天输出添加 Markdown 渲染,可灵活复制/粘贴代码块
  • 远程终端:添加新的多行文本输入,可快速向终端输入大量文本数据
  • 远程 CLI:添加免费使用层级,免费账户每天限制30分钟
  • 今后的更新日志将从服务器加载,支持将更新日志翻译为所有语言

10.0.0.0

  • 编辑器:预测键盘的括号/引号现在支持长按选择括号类型
  • 改进透明背景主题效果
  • AI:将"AI Completions"重命名为"Credits","Paid Completions"改为"Extra Credits","Free Completions"改为"Monthly Credits"
  • Git:改进差异比较算法
  • Git:修复子模块差异的处理问题
  • Git:对缓存和状态检查进行多项优化
  • Search:性能改进
  • UI:小幅性能改进
  • UI:改进多个页面,如实验室、账户设置和项目页面
  • Perf:提升大型项目中文件操作和搜索的整体性能
  • 设置:由于使用率低,移除默认背景
  • Webview:新增分辨率选择功能,可测试不同的模拟屏幕尺寸
  • 高级版 Spck CLI 用于远程编辑,可从远程机器访问终端程序
    • 适合在移动端使用 AI 代理,如 Claude/Gemini/Codex
    • 在移动设备上运行 Python 程序
    • 编辑时需要网络连接
  • 改进使用自定义背景时的半透明/玻璃主题效果
  • 改进自定义背景主题(现在侧边菜单和下拉菜单也支持透明效果)
  • 修复:修复 phenotype_storage_info 在内部存储中显示的问题
  • 重新设计主网站
  • Spck Lite:独家动画"Flow"背景

9.7.2.0

  • Markdown:新增 JSON 高亮支持
  • 编辑器:修复粘贴文本时自动换行渲染异常的长期存在的问题
  • UI:对字体和整体外观进行小幅调整

9.7.1.0

  • 编辑器:改进自动补全匹配算法
  • AI:修复生成代码中的 Markdown 检测问题

9.7.0.0

  • 编辑器:修复 9.6.x 版本引入的自动换行渲染问题,部分行可能显示异常
  • 编辑器:修复更改某些特定编辑器设置会影响自定义代码片段编辑的问题
  • 编辑器:在触摸键盘上使用 Ctrl-C 时添加通知消息
  • AI:调整 AI 提示词的布局,提升移动端体验
  • AI:将 AI 提示词编辑器切换为与代码编辑器相同
  • AI:为 AI 提示词编辑器添加复制/粘贴按钮
  • AI:为 AI 提示词编辑器添加触摸光标
  • AI:修复"Before Cursor"上下文算法的问题,小幅改进免费/付费补全的显示
  • AI:关闭提示词编辑器后仍可查看上一次的 AI 提示词结果
  • AI:Supporter/Gold 订阅用户现在可以使用 Claude Opus

9.6.3.0

  • 编辑器:修复 Ctrl-K、Ctrl-P 快捷键失效的问题
  • 编辑器:修复按下扩展键时光标在行首偏移的输入问题
  • 编辑器:修复重命名后标签名称未更新的问题
  • UI:最近文件和命令面板在打开/关闭后保留上次的搜索结果
  • UI:在各种对话框的输入框中自动选中文本
  • Markdown:为引用块等特定元素添加样式
  • 在设置的关于部分添加文档链接

9.6.2.0

  • Git:修复扩展名重命名和文件移动操作的问题
  • 文件:更好地支持扩展名重命名
  • 文件:添加 .mdx 扩展名支持
  • 文件:修复 .md、.json 文件不显示以文本方式编辑选项的问题
  • 改版 spck.io 网站,网站的文档部分即将上线

9.6.1.0

  • 编辑器:修复自动换行模式下颜色预览光标位置的问题
  • 编辑器:颜色预览现已扩展到 XML、HTML 和 SVG 模式
  • 预览器:为图片预览器添加缓存清除功能
  • CSS:使颜色预览语法高亮更加精确,避免匹配 ID 选择器
  • AI:SVG 代码检测扩展至 XML
  • AI:在无代码模式中添加追加选项
  • Labs:无需登录即可查看评论

9.6.0.0

  • Git:实现提交的暂存区/非暂存区功能
    • 更改还原行为,还原到上次暂存状态,如果未暂存则还原到 HEAD 状态
    • 还原操作不会还原已暂存的文件,仅还原未暂存的文件
    • 在提交消息提示中添加全部暂存选项
    • 徽章计数现在显示暂存和未暂存更改的总数
  • Git:修复差异视图中还原按钮无法点击的问题
  • Git:添加 Git 提交快捷键 (⌘⇧C)
  • 设置:添加检测缩进大小设置,自动检测文件的缩进大小
  • 编辑器:可通过启发式方法自动确定缩进大小
  • 编辑器:添加错误徽章,显示文件中的错误数量
  • 编辑器:添加更改文件换行符的功能 (CRLF/LF)
  • AI:新增追加选项,将文本插入到文件末尾
  • AI:修复编辑器有当前选区时插入选项高亮文本的问题
  • CSS:为 8 位十六进制颜色代码添加高亮和颜色预览
  • Search:修复二进制文件中断搜索结果的问题
  • Search:修复过滤通配符模式不匹配文件夹通配符模式的问题(例如 src/*)
  • Site:Web 应用现在允许从 Github、Bitbucket、Gitlab、Azure 进行 Git 克隆

9.5.0.0

  • CSS:实现行内颜色预览
  • CSS:修复 CSS 模式下显示 SCSS 补全的问题
  • 自动补全:改进排序算法
  • 编辑器:修复 CSS 模式下显示提示 (Ctrl-I) 的问题
  • 编辑器:在空格横幅弹窗中添加自动换行配置
  • 编辑器:打开预览时取消编辑器焦点
    • 修复某些设备上软键盘被预览遮挡的问题
  • Git:在 URL 输入框中预填 https:// 以方便使用

9.4.3.0

  • 编辑器:与虚拟 Ctrl 或 Alt 键以及触摸光标交互时自动聚焦编辑器
  • 编辑器:修复触摸光标有时与当前选区不匹配的显示问题
  • 自动补全:修复大写字母补全的匹配问题
  • UI:在主菜单选项中添加 Git 凭据
  • AI:修复在 AI 提示词中切换到原始标签页时的问题
  • AI:将 AI 提示词改为多行输入,支持更复杂的自定义提示词
  • AI:修复整个文件的替换文本选项的问题
  • AI:修复提示词显示渲染的问题
  • AI:增强 AI 提示词中代码块的提取功能,使其匹配当前文件类型
  • 自定义代码片段:为编辑器添加复制/粘贴按钮
  • 自定义代码片段:为编辑器添加触摸光标
  • 设置:添加新的显示提示设置,可关闭自动补全提示弹窗

9.4.2.0

  • 编辑器:支持 CSS 中新的嵌套类语法
  • 编辑器:改进 JSX 和 TSX 的编辑行为
  • 编辑器:改进括号插入的编辑行为 () [] {}
  • 编辑器:改进最近文件的搜索排序
  • 自动补全:修复自动补全显示不完整单词的问题
  • 自动补全:改进搜索排序算法

9.4.1.0

  • 编辑器:改进最近文件对话框中的路径搜索算法
  • 编辑器:新增快捷键 Ctrl-K/Command-K 显示键盘快捷键
  • 编辑器:JSON 预览器现在在解析无效 JSON 时显示错误
  • 编辑器:关闭行号时添加少量内边距
  • 编辑器:切换文件时当前文件路径自动滚动到末尾
  • 编辑器:Markdown 预览、JSON 预览和以文本方式编辑现在遵循字体大小设置
  • Git:允许在差异查看器中选择文本并添加复制键
  • Git:修复差异查看器的小问题
  • AI:AI 提示词预览现在隐藏行号
  • 设置:修复显示行号的小问题
  • 设置:将键盘快捷键与命令面板合并
    • 高级用户可从命令面板执行编辑器命令

9.4.0.0

  • 编辑器:重新设计触摸光标的手势控制
  • 编辑器:增大触摸光标手柄尺寸
  • 编辑器:提高触摸光标位置追踪的准确性
  • 编辑器:增大编辑器初始默认设置的文本大小
  • 编辑器:修复使用"以文本方式编辑"模式时深色模式的背景颜色
  • 设置:为 Supporters+ 添加新的命令面板功能键
    • 之前仅在 Spck Editor Lite 中可用
  • 设置:添加触摸光标设置,可禁用触摸光标手柄(用于鼠标等)
  • AI:更改 AI 提示词中选中文本的行为
    • 选中的文本始终覆盖"包含代码"选项